The Company specializes in the rental of heavy equipment to contractors, with lease terms ranging from one week to over a year. Long-term rental agreements help stabilize revenue and reduce volatility. All equipment is rigorously maintained, with field inspections conducted at least every ten days. Equipment is typically run for 15,000–16,000 hours, with an upper threshold of approximately 20,000 hours, subject to repair history and condition.
